Analysis
The most recent figure for sawnwood — import quantity, per capita in New Zealand is 0.0103 m3 per person, measured in 2024.
That represents a change of up 1.1% on the previous year and down 3.2% over ten years.
Over the whole period, sawnwood — import quantity, per capita in New Zealand peaked at 0.046 m3 per person in 1961 and was at its lowest, 0.0058 m3 per person, in 1978.
That places New Zealand 103rd out of 184 countries with data for 2024,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Sawnwood — Import quantity div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Sawnwood — Import quantity ÷ Population, total
Computed from
- Sawnwood — Import quantity Food and Agriculture Organization of the United Nations
- Population, total World Population Prospects, United Nations (UN)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
